PPP1R12C ELISA kits are immunoassay tools for the measurement of the protein protein phosphatase 1 regulatory subunit 12C, which is encoded by the PPP1R12C gene in humans. Functionally, this protein is reported to regulate myosin phosphatase activity. The canonical protein structure is reported to have an amino acid sequence of 782 residues and a mass of 84.9 kDa. It is known to be localized in the cytoplasm and is ubiquitously expressed across many tissue types. As many as 5 protein isoforms have been reported. The protein has been noted to be post-translationally phosphorylated. Other alias names for this target include LENG3, MBS85, p84, p85, leukocyte receptor cluster (LRC) encoded novel gene 3, and AAVS1.
